Given below are two statements
Statement I : The numerical value of the equilibrium constant for a reaction indicates the extent of the reaction.
Statement II : An equilibrium constant givesw information about the rate at which the equilibrium is reached.
In the light of the above statements, choose the most appropriate answer from the options given below:
- Statement I is correct but Statement II is incorrect.
- Statement I is incorrect but Statement II is correct.
- Both Statement I and Statement II are correct.
- Both Statement I and Statement II are incorrect.
Answer
(A) Statement I is correct but Statement II is incorrect.
